Abstract

The effect of K-conservation on the photodissociation of ketene has been investigated. Rate constants and photofragment excitation (PHOFEX) spectra have been calculated using phase space theory (PST) in a helicity basis. While the effect of K-conservation on rate constants is relatively subtle, PHOFEX spectra with state-selected reactant molecules appear to provide a feasible way to experimentally resolve the question of K-conservation.
